Output efb8204023215c094e82e937ea49be4c8cceaf4a807fbd45416fc7c8d2239dd3:0

value
33158
script pubkey
OP_0 OP_PUSHBYTES_20 391218642430403c56489e743840b8b64e53936c
address
bc1q8yfpsepyxpqrc4jgne6rss9cke898ymvktmvle
transaction
efb8204023215c094e82e937ea49be4c8cceaf4a807fbd45416fc7c8d2239dd3
confirmations
50883
spent
true